Description
Flavour Me Pizza is located in downtown Calgary just off of 8th street SW. We are a popular location for drop in lunches and also offer takeout orders, delivery and catering services. Stop on by and taste the best gourmet pizza in town!
Flavour Me Pizza is located in downtown Calgary just off of 8th street SW. We are a popular location for drop in lunches and also offer takeout orders, delivery and catering services. Stop on by and taste the best gourmet pizza in town!